Fence construction in Montreal

A fence has to follow the yard’s actual limits and levels while staying solid through freeze cycles. The visit is used to inspect access, existing posts, grade changes and connections to nearby structures.

What the work can include

  • Removal or repair of existing sections
  • Post preparation and installation
  • Fence frames, boards and panels
  • Gates, latches and adjustments
  • Transitions to decks and nearby structures

Items to clarify before work

  • The limits, heights and lengths to cover
  • Access for materials and preparation
  • Style, privacy level and gate openings
  • Grade changes and elements that need to stay
